#9f6353 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f6353 is composed of 62.4% red, 38.8%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.7% magenta, 47.8%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 12.6 degrees, a saturation of 31.4% and a lightness of 47.5%. #9f6353 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6a6 with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#9f6353

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9f6353

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7978 is the less saturated color, while #e93809 is the most saturated one.
